comparison tests/test-bookmarks-pushpull.t @ 48243:76c071bba40d

bookmarks: add support for `mirror` mode to `incoming` This is more consistent. Differential Revision: https://phab.mercurial-scm.org/D11676
author Pierre-Yves David <pierre-yves.david@octobus.net>
date Fri, 15 Oct 2021 04:25:58 +0200
parents 4d2ab365699e
children b56858d85a7b
comparison
equal deleted inserted replaced
48242:4d2ab365699e 48243:76c071bba40d
501 Z 2:0d2164f0ce0d 501 Z 2:0d2164f0ce0d
502 foo -1:000000000000 502 foo -1:000000000000
503 * foobar 1:9b140be10808 503 * foobar 1:9b140be10808
504 $ cp .hg/bookmarks .hg/bookmarks.bak 504 $ cp .hg/bookmarks .hg/bookmarks.bak
505 $ hg book -d X 505 $ hg book -d X
506 $ hg incoming --bookmark -v ../a
507 comparing with ../a
508 searching for changed bookmarks
509 @ 0d2164f0ce0d diverged
510 X 0d2164f0ce0d added
511 $ hg incoming --bookmark -v ../a --config 'paths.*:bookmarks.mode=babar'
512 (paths.*:bookmarks.mode has unknown value: "babar")
513 comparing with ../a
514 searching for changed bookmarks
515 @ 0d2164f0ce0d diverged
516 X 0d2164f0ce0d added
517 $ hg incoming --bookmark -v ../a --config 'paths.*:bookmarks.mode=mirror'
518 comparing with ../a
519 searching for changed bookmarks
520 @ 0d2164f0ce0d changed
521 @foo 000000000000 removed
522 X 0d2164f0ce0d added
523 X@foo 000000000000 removed
524 foo 000000000000 removed
525 foobar 000000000000 removed
506 $ hg pull ../a --config 'paths.*:bookmarks.mode=mirror' 526 $ hg pull ../a --config 'paths.*:bookmarks.mode=mirror'
507 pulling from ../a 527 pulling from ../a
508 searching for changes 528 searching for changes
509 no changes found 529 no changes found
510 $ hg book 530 $ hg book